You don't need special rotors. The TPMS units in the wheels are a pressure sensor and transmitter in one. They transmit directly to the BCM via the same receiver used by the remote door lock system. I suspect the bolt you see sticking out of your hub is the one used on the coupes to keep you from putting the rear tires on the friont.

and transmits a detected air pressure signal in the form of a radio wave. The remote keyless entry receiver receives the air pressure signal transmitted by the transmitter in each wheel. The BCM reads the air pressure signal received by the remote keyless entry receiver, and controls the low tire pressure warning lamp operations. It also has a judgement function to detect a system malfunction
Condition Low tire pressure warning lamp
Less than 166 kPa (1.7 kg/cm2 , 24 psi) [Note 1] ON
Less than 188 kPa (1.9 kg/cm2 , 27 psi) [Note 2] ON
Low tire pressure warning system malfunction [Other diagnostic item] Warning lamp flashes 1 min, then turns ON.
According to the picture in the 07 manual, the sensor/xmtr actually penetrates the wheel body, requiring an o-ring to be replaced on each sensor/xmtr after each maintaince. Meaning that aftermkt wheels will have to be drilled inorder to continue using the TPSS or having that TPSS diabled if it can be. I would not like to have that light on all the time...
